6 Package SOAP APIs for C++

W3C: "SOAP is a lightweight protocol for exchange of information in a decentralized, distributed environment. It is an XML based protocol that consists of three parts: an envelope that defines a framework for describing what is in a message and how to process it, a set of encoding rules for expressing instances of application-defined datatypes, and a convention for representing remote procedure calls and responses."

The structure of a SOAP message is:

[SOAP message (XML document)
   [SOAP envelope
      [SOAP header?
            element*
      ]
      [SOAP body
           (element* | Fault)?
      ]
   ]
]
